SANTA MONICA, Calif. (Feb. 23, 2026) - The city of Santa Monica and the Black Santa Monica Community Group will host the 11th annual Black History Greens Festival on Saturday, Feb. 28, at Virginia Avenue Park from 11 a.m. to 4 p.m.
The free community event is part of the city's Black History Month celebration, and the theme for 2026 is "Boots on the Ground," honoring community and culture.
Event attendees can check out three greens cooking demonstrations with local chefs, family activities including book readings and giveaways, performances, vendors and wellness information. Special guest KJLH radio's Arron "BOBO" Arnell will return for a second year as the master of ceremonies and DJ Dense will be spinning throughout the event.
